如何更换OpenAI API Key?一步步教你更换密钥(openai api key如何更换)
I. 甚么是OpenAI API Key
A. OpenAI API Key的定义和作用
OpenAI API Key是使用OpenAI API的授权凭证。开发者可使用OpenAI API Key来访问OpenAI的各种人工智能模型,例如GPT⑶语言模型、DALL-E图象生成器、Codex编程语言模型。
B. OpenAI API Key的重要性和安全性
OpenAI API Key是访问OpenAI API的重要标识。它具有高度的安全性,需要正确管理和保护,以免未授权访问和滥用。
II. 如何获得OpenAI API Key
A. 在OpenAI官网注册并登录
1. 访问OpenAI官网并登录账
使用Python怎样创建一个语音对话ChatGPT的程序?
问题:
怎样使用Python创建一个语音对话ChatGPT的程序?
答案:
使用Python创建一个语音对话ChatGPT的程序可以通过以下步骤实现:
- 安装必要的库:安装Python的ChatGPT库和其他需要的依赖库。
- 导入必要的库:在Python程序中导入ChatGPT库和其他所需的库。
- 设置API密钥:获得OpenAI API密钥,并设置密钥以便在程序中使用。
- 创建ChatGPT实例:使用导入的ChatGPT库创建一个ChatGPT模型的实例。
- 与ChatGPT对话:使用ChatGPT实例与模型进行对话,并根据需要获得和处理对话的回复。
- 运行程序:运行Python程序并进行语音对话。
下面是一个示例代码:
“`python
import openai
import sounddevice as sd
# 设置API密钥
openai.api_key = ‘your-openai-api-key’
# 创建ChatGPT实例
chatgpt = openai.ChatCompletion.create(
model=”gpt⑶.5-turbo”
)
# 与ChatGPT对话
print(“开始对话:”)
while True:
user_input = input(“用户:”)
if user_input.lower() == ‘退出’:
break
# 发送用户输入并获得ChatGPT的回复
response = chatgpt.messages.create(
model=”gpt⑶.5-turbo”,
messages=[
{“role”: “system”, “content”: “用户:{}”.format(user_input)},
{“role”: “user”, “content”: user_input}
]
)
# 提取ChatGPT的回复
reply = response[‘choices’][0][‘message’][‘content’]
print(“ChatGPT:{}”.format(reply))
sd.speak(reply) # 语音输出回复
“`
使用以上代码,您可以创建一个简单的语音对话ChatGPT程序。用户可以通过输入文本与ChatGPT进行对话,并从程序中获得ChatGPT的回复。
怎么将AutoGPT部署到云函数?
问题:
怎么将AutoGPT部署到云函数?
答案:
将AutoGPT部署到云函数通常可以通过以下步骤来实现:
- 选择云函数平台:选择一个支持Python的云函数平台,例如Google Cloud Functions、AWS Lambda等。
- 创建云函数:在所选的云函数平台上创建一个新的云函数。
- 上传代码:将AutoGPT的代码文件上传到云函数平台的函数代码中。
- 设置依赖库:配置云函数依赖库以确保AutoGPT及其依赖的库可以正常运行。
- 配置触发器:根据需要配置云函数的触发器,例如HTTP要求触发器或定时触发器。
- 部署云函数:将云函数部署到云平台,并获得API访问链接或其他必要的部署信息。
- 测试部署:通过发送要求或触发云函数来测试部署会不会成功。
根据您选择的云函数平台和具体的需求,上述步骤可能会有所区别。请根据您的实际情况选择合适的云函数平台,并参考平台提供的文档和指南进行部署。
如何避免openai的API密钥被封号?
问题:
如何避免openai的API密钥被封号?
答案:
为了避免openai的API密钥被封号,请遵守以下建议和最好实践:
- 保密API密钥:不要与他人分享您的openai的API密钥,确保只有授权的人可以访问。
- 限制访问权限:限制API密钥的访问权限,只允许特定的IP地址、用户或装备访问API。
- 使用安全通讯协议:在使用API密钥时,使用HTTPS等安全的通讯协议来传输数据以确保安全性。
- 监控使用情况:定期监控和审查API密钥的使用情况,及时发现异常活动并采取必要的措施。
- 更新密钥:定期更新API密钥,以减少被滥用的风险。
- 控制权限:只给予API密钥足够的权限,避免给予没必要要的权限。
- 遵守平台规则:遵照openai平台的使用规则和政策,不要进行背规操作。
- 参考文档:详细了解openai的安全和使用规定,遵守官方文档中提供的安全建议。
遵守以上安全措施可以下降openai的API密钥被封号的风险,保护API密钥的安全性。